Blazor Programming

Blazor Programming

دوره آموزشی برنامه نویسی Blazor (Introduction to ASP.NET Core Blazor ASP.NET Core Blazor supported platforms Tooling for ASP.NET Core Blazor ASP.NET Core Blazor hosting models Build a Blazor todo list app)

مروری بر دوره

Blazor فریمورکی از خانواده .NET است که از C# یا Razor و HTML استفاده می کند و در مرورگر به همراه WebAssembly اجرا می شود. فریمورک بلازور تمامی مزایای یک فریمورک وب برای واسط کاربری (UI) را بوسیله .NET در سمت کاربر و سرور (به صورت اختیاری) فراهم می کند.

Blazor به شما اجازه می دهد تا بتوانید UI های مربوط به برنامه‌های وب خود را به صورت تعاملی و interactive با استفاده از زبان برنامه نویسی سی شارپ به جای استفاده کردن از زبان برنامه نویسی جاوا اسکریپت ایجاد کنید. این موضوع به تمامی برنامه نویسانی که تجربه توسعه دادن نرم افزار با استفاده از زبان برنامه نویسی سی شارپ را دارند یک خبر بسیار خوب خواهد بود. با استفاده از اپلیکیشن های Blazor شما می توانید کدهای مربوط به برنامه وب خود را به صورت reusable و یا قابل استفاده مجدد ایجاد کنید. این موضوع با لحاظ کردن کامپوننت ها با استفاده از کدهای زبان برنامه نویسی سی شارپ و  HTML و CSS ایجاد خواهد شد. در واقع با استفاده از Blazor هم کدهای سمت Server و هم کدهای سمت Client با زبان سی شارپ نوشته خواهند شد. این موضوع به شما این امکان را می دهد تا کدها و کتابخانه های خود را به ساده ترین شکل ممکن به اشتراک بگذارید.

فریم ورک Blazor یکی از قابلیت های ASP.NET به عنوان یک فریم ورک محبوب توسعه اپلیکیشن های وب به حساب می آید. این فریم ورک با استفاده از ابزارها و کتابخانه‌ های خود امروزه توانسته است به عنوان یکی از محبوب ترین ابزارهای ساخت اپلیکیشن های وب مورد استفاده قرار بگیرد.

سرفصل ها

Introduction to ASP.NET Core Blazor

ASP.NET Core Blazor supported platforms

Tooling for ASP.NET Core Blazor

ASP.NET Core Blazor hosting models

Build a Blazor todo list app

Use ASP.NET Core SignalR with a hosted Blazor WebAssembly app

ASP.NET Core Blazor routing

ASP.NET Core Blazor configuration

ASP.NET Core Blazor dependency injection

ASP.NET Core Blazor environments

ASP.NET Core Blazor logging

Handle errors in ASP.NET Core Blazor apps

ASP.NET Core Blazor hosting model configuration

ASP.NET Core Blazor globalization and localization

ASP.NET Core Blazor layouts

ASP.NET Core Blazor file uploads

Call JavaScript functions from .NET methods in ASP.NET Core Blazor

Call .NET methods from JavaScript functions in ASP.NET Core Blazor

Call a web API from ASP.NET Core Blazor

ASP.NET Core Blazor authentication and authorization

ASP.NET Core Blazor state management

Debug ASP.NET Core Blazor WebAssembly

Lazy load assemblies in ASP.NET Core Blazor WebAssembly

ASP.NET Core Blazor WebAssembly performance best practices

Test components in ASP.NET Core Blazor

Build Progressive Web Applications with ASP.NET Core Blazor WebAssembly

Host and deploy ASP.NET Core Blazor

(ASP.NET Core Blazor Server with Entity Framework Core (EFCore

ASP.NET Core Blazor advanced scenarios

Built-in components 

پیش نیازها

مسلط به ASP.Net و SQL Server

تقویم آموزشی
9933
Blazor Programming

Blazor Programming

دوره آموزشی برنامه نویسی Blazor (Introduction to ASP.NET Core Blazor ASP.NET Core Blazor supported platforms Tooling for ASP.NET Core Blazor ASP.NET Core Blazor hosting models Build a Blazor todo list app)

مدرس: مهندس منصور فرشیدی

طول دوره: ۲۰ ساعت
شهریه: ۱,۱۰۰,۰۰۰ تومان

تاریخ شروع: ۱۳۹۹/۱۰/۱۸
پنج شنبه . جمعه
زمان برگزاری: ۲۰:۰۰ - ۱۶:۰۰
بصورت حضوری و لایو همراه داشتن لپتاپ الزامی می باشد.

با ما همراه بشین

  • موسسه انفورماتیک بین الملل
  • تلفن تماس: ۰۵۱۳۷۶۴۹۳۳۹ - ۰۵۱۳۷۶۳۲۸۱۲
  • ایمیل: i3center.inc@gmail.com
  • ساعت کاری: از ۸:۳۰ تا ۲۰:۰۰
  • مشهد - بلوار فردوسی - مهدی ۳ - پلاک ۲۴
  • آمار
  • بازدیدهای سایت: 3802110
  • کلاس های آموزشی: 94
  • استادان: 62
  • پرسنل: 10